Output 35a85f35ddd947f96a3055f53e2df7653b21b6e09c14a7860753eb63e0bbd86a:1

value
49894119
script pubkey
OP_0 OP_PUSHBYTES_20 8623c1e75b12a8458ea083367c442ff2bd2c952f
address
ltc1qsc3ure6mz25ytr4qsvm8c3p0727je9f0uerh3m
transaction
35a85f35ddd947f96a3055f53e2df7653b21b6e09c14a7860753eb63e0bbd86a
spent
true